For many singers, the stage is like a second home. The audience singing in chorus and the tributes from fans help create the atmosphere that boosts the careers of many artists.
But Minas Gerais singer and composer Marcos Almeida decided to take this experience to an environment even closer to the public: the fan's home.

With the "De Casa em Casa" project, the artist performs musical performances inside the homes of admirers of his work, transforming family spaces into improvised stages for concerts marked by proximity and the exchange of affection between artist and audience.

In the 31st edition of the initiative, held on June 1st, in Piratininga (SP), the artist spoke to g1 and told us about the project, which seeks to rescue the origins of his career in music.
“It's a memory of something that happened at the beginning of my career in 2008. Nobody asked us to play, but we had listeners, so I decided to get them together at a friend's house”, he explains.
The singer, who gained national prominence when he performed the songs "Sê Valente" and "Vem Me Socorrer" on the soundtrack of the soap opera "Vai na Fé", shown on TV Globo, states that the intimate format helps to strengthen the connection with the public.
"The idea is that the stage and audience are abolished and become one 'home'. When I'm on stage, I remember home. And when I'm at home, I feel even more comfortable", he confesses.

Open house for music
At each performance, the host provides the space for the artist and his team to set up the performance space. Friends and family also participate in the organization, helping to create the welcoming environment that characterizes the project.
At the tour stop in Piratininga, it was Davi Nunes who opened the doors of his home and prepared the place with seats, decoration with golden lights and even a special coffee to welcome the team.
“We found out that he would be in Bauru and we happened to be able to sign up for him to come [...] We all here at home really like Marcos and admire his work”, he says.
“We wanted to think of a cozy space for everyone, including those who are coming here to serve us”, he adds.

In addition to the residents of the house, fans of the singer from neighboring cities, such as Bauru, Marília and Garça (SP), traveled to watch the performance.
Among them were the couple Richard Ozelin and Izabela Brilhante Ozelin, from Marília, who traveled more than an hour to participate in the meeting.
“It's a warmer moment, so it's more enjoyable because you're in contact with the singer,” says Richard.
"We really admire his work. We practice the lyrics and listen to the songs practically the whole week", adds Izabela.

Public and artist reception
“De Casa em Casa” closes a stage of the tour that has also visited cities such as Belo Horizonte and Ouro Preto (MG), São José dos Campos (SP), Porto Alegre (RS) and Curitiba (PR).
“It has been incredible to meet these people again in this native environment of my music, but above all to understand this Brazilian hospitality in a very special way", highlights Marcos.
Collecting the affection of fans around Brazil, the singer recognizes the welcoming and warm character of those who accompany him.
"Brazilians open their homes and want to welcome foreigners. In the end, we discover that we are all the same", celebrates the artist. Marcos Almeida travels around Brazil with the project "De Casa em Casa", a proposal for intimate shows in fans' homes
